2L Isabelle Zakheim (Loyola Law School and intern at Donaldson Callif Perez LLP) talks about landing internships, navigating the first weeks on the job, and managing a packed schedule as a full-time student.
She covers what actually works in cold outreach, how to get up to speed on a project when no one has time to brief you, building professional and personal trust with colleagues, and why the informal moments -- quick coffees, passing conversations, offhand feedback -- are where the real learning happens.
